<div class='os_post_top_link'><a href='http://www.engadget.com/2011/04/11/transformer-rooted-before-asus-can-get-it-out-the-door/' target='_blank'>http://www.engadget.com/2011/04/11/...t-out-the-door/</a><br /><br /></div><p><em>"Before it hit store shelves here in the US MoDaCo founder Paul O'Brien managed to get his hands on one of the upcoming Android devices and, with a little help from Twitter user BumbleDroid, gained root access to the tablet."</em></p><p><img src="http://images.thoughtsmedia.com/resizer/thumbs/size/600/adt/auto/1302742913.usr309.jpg" style="border: 1px solid #d2d2bb;" /></p><p>The quote above pretty much says it all.&nbsp; The Asus Transformer has already been rooted!&nbsp; So why would anyone want this?&nbsp; Well, apparently this Honeycomb tablet <a href="http://www.gottabemobile.com/2011/03/31/asus-eee-pad-transformer-lands-at-best-buy-coming-soon-for-400/" target="_blank">will be available with</a> a Tegra 2, 1GB of RAM, 16GB of storage, 1.2MP webcam, and a WXGA 10.1" IPS LCD for $400.&nbsp; Not bad and you already know you can root it, plus you can add a keyboard to the thing if you want (that's the "Transformer" part)!&nbsp; Will anyone be picking this up when it's released or will it at least make you hold off on a purchase until you get to try it?</p>
